Think about what drives companies like MSFT, CSCO and ORCL. They are the tech monsters. It's faster processors. Without faster processors, you can't or don't need to greatly expand the capabilities of software or routers etc. So Intel's ability to increase processing speed drives the whole tech sector.

Now there are two things that limit Intel's ability to increase processing power. The first is the so-called 'quarter micron problem' which is that it is getting difficult to cut finer and finer lines in semiconductors. After all, electrons have a physical width. Cymer is working on ultraviolet lasers to assist in the etching problem here. The other problem is the so-called 'performance gap' which is where RMBS comes in. Even if Intel makes faster processors, ultimately it doesn't matter if the processor has to wait to get information from memory (DRAM). So, the rate limiting step becomes accessing memory. Intel knows it and needs a solution that works or it can't sell us new processors every two years.

While RMBS isn't the only solution, it currently looks like the best. And if Intel continues to anoint RMBS as the solution, this stock will be a home run.
